    Don’t be a boar! Tune in and hear how Larry returns from Tucson with a fear of cacti and wild pigs. That leads to a discussion of Larry’s newest volcano, volcano #3! And Larry does an inspired recitation of the poem Gunga Din, then talks about the movie of the same name. Quote of the week: “They make the Javelina pigs look like tea time.”

    Larry has peaceful and nearly spiritual experience at the supermarket and tries to understand why and how to make it happen again. Then, Larry talks about a great scene from the movie “Miller’s Crossing” and recites the Shakespeare Sonnet “So Are You To My Thoughts As Food To Life.” Quote of the week: “Sonnet 75, that wasn’t the first one he wrote. There were 74 before that.”

    Larry tells the story of the biggest laugh he ever had, at a classical musical recital when he was a teenager. And hear about his trip to the quiet confines of a watch store. Then Larry talks about the great movie, “The Untouchables” and recites the poem “I Am In Need Of Music” by Elizabeth Bishop. And has a hoofer ever ankled a biopic that went on to be boffo at the B.O.? Tune in and find out! Quote Of The Week: “Here’s a million dollars, just stand up.”
